Hello, many of you have probably seen the preview pictures of my customized CollectA feathered T-Rex. List of modifications I made are:

1) Trimmed down the Mohawk
2) Added/bulked up the feathering around the back if the skull plus changed the style of feathering in that area.
3) Added thin light feathering around the fenestra and at the back of the lower jaw.
4) Filled in all gaps around the head and legs.
5) Full repaint

The color scheme I chose is based on the Bearded Vulture. Here are the pictures. Hope you all like him, I call him the "Big Chief"
